Grady Rippeon Grady Rippeon Grady Rippeon 6'1" | 190 lbs | FO | Right Hand Mt. St. Joseph | 2026 State MD is set to join his brother at Jacksonville next year, where his older brother is already the starting face-off guy, and it’s easy to see why that pipeline fits. Rippeon has a chance to tilt games in the Gaels’ favor because he’s one of the more skilled FOGOs in the MIAA. He wins a lot of draws clean forward, and he’s quick enough after the win that teams can’t fall asleep — if you don’t respect him as a scoring threat, he’ll run right through your lock-offs and dunk it. He showed that at NHSLS this fall against Brophy Prep.

What I like most is that he’s not a one-trick pony at the stripe. He can battle with top-level opponents, counter when teams adjust, vary his exits, and get physical when the draw turns into a scrap. And when you pair him with Nico Dinisio Nico Dinisio Nico Dinisio 5'10" | LSM | Right Hand Mount Saint Joseph | 2027 State MD on the wing — one of those ground-ball magnets — Mount St. Joe has a real chance to control the ground game and win the possession battle off face-offs.
